Alistair is one of East and Southern Africa’s fastest growing service companies, providing a variety of self-delivered logistics solutions with core competencies in road freight and operational hire of material handling equipment. The business has gone from strength to strength, growing quickly in both its geographical coverage and variety of services offered to clients. At the moment, the Group employees over 800 personnel, delivers services across sixteen countries and is poised for significant further expansion.

Accountabilities & Responsibility Areas 

  • Reporting to the Head of Operations
  • Act as the single point of contact for all Zambia-based fleet and border operations.
  • Coordinate with ALZ Senior Fleet Managers, Regional Ops Leads, Border Teams, Driver Management, and HSSEQ to ensure trip execution and turnaround.
  • Manage daily engagement with local authorities (ZRA, RTSA, Police), supported by our compliance and government liaison teams.
  • Ensure compliance with all permits, licensing, regulatory documentation, and procedural requirements for the ALZ Fleet.
  • Provide daily truck progress updates to clients (via Client Liaisons) and ensure data accuracy through regular audit spot checks.
  • Handle operational-level client complaints related to ALZ and feedback.
  • Lead the Zambian Ops team and ensure cross-functional coordination (Driver Management, Fleet, Workshop, Clearing, Compliance, Finance, etc.).
  • Monitor staff performance and support local recruitment and onboarding.
  • Track delays, analyze trip data, and identify inefficiencies.
  • Submit weekly and monthly operational reports.
  • Take first-line responsibility for incident response (theft, breakdowns, accidents) and escalate major issues as required.

Skills and Qualifications

Minimum Qualifications:

  • Bachelor’s degree in Logistics, Business Administration, or a related field (or equivalent vocational/logistics experience).
  • At least 5 years of experience in regional or cross-border logistics operations.
  • Familiarity with customs procedures, border agency coordination, and trip management.
  • Proficiency in transport management systems, or other operational systems.
  • Experience managing operational teams across departments (fleet, clearing, driver management, etc.).

Core Skills:

  • Strong leadership and team delegation skills, with a hands-on management style.
  • Ability to resolve operational challenges quickly and engage both internal and external stakeholders (e.g., police, ZRA, RIT, security vendors).
  • Strong understanding of compliance requirements, licensing, and border procedures.
  • High-level coordination and communication skills for client updates, staff direction, and cross-department reporting.
  • Financial stewardship including float management, fuel controls, and cost awareness.

Key Attributes:

  • Detail-oriented and highly accountable.
  • Operationally resilient and able to work under pressure.
  • Proactive, ethical, and capable of leading by example.
  • Strong judgment, capable of independently managing and escalating issues as needed.
